    To apply for a visa, the following materials and documents should be provided:

    1) First of all, the employing unit shall apply to the local immigration bureau and submit relevant supporting materials. There are mainly a letter of appointment, an employment contract, a certificate of employment, treatment and employment conditions, and a letter of guarantee issued by the main person in charge of the employing unit, as well as supporting materials that can fully prove the financial expenditure, tax paying ability, establishment and development of the employing unit. In addition, it is also necessary to submit the resumes of the hired candidates and the family relationship form at home and abroad.

    2) After approval by the Immigration Bureau of the Ministry of Justice in conjunction with other relevant departments, a Certificate of Eligibility will be issued with the number 4-1-7 or 4-1-12.

    3) The applicant shall apply for an entry visa at the Japanese Embassy or Consulate General in China with the Certificate of Eligibility provided by the Japanese employer. Among them, professors, artists, foreign pastors, journalists, investors and managers, lawyers and accountants can be valid for six months, one year or three years, and the other eight categories of personnel can be granted three-month, six-month or one-year visas.

    Foreigners applying for employment or work visas must have a college degree or above and certain work experience. The spouses and minor children of the above-mentioned entrants may also apply for entry permits together. If approved, you will be able to obtain a Certificate of Eligibility with the number 4-1-15.

    Some people want to go to Japan as trainees. What are the requirements for going to Japan as a trainee? 86 for everyone to analyze. When entering into a training agreement between a Chinese sending agency and a Japanese receiving organization, the following basic requirements are set for trainees:

    1.Strong sense of mission and enthusiasm for training;

    2.The technology learned in China is consistent with the technology studied in Japan, and the person has been engaged in this work for more than two years;

    3.I have no training experience in Japan.

    4.Have a recommendation from a national or local administrative authority in China;

    5.After completing your training in Japan, you will be sure to return to your home company.

    6.Be at least 18 years old and under 38 years old; (The age of the latter varies depending on the training industry, and the requirements are different) 7Graduated from high school or equivalent; (Agricultural trainee junior high school or above) 8

    Those who have a sufficient level of Japanese language proficiency to cope with the training. Generally speaking, the Chinese sending agency selects candidates from among those who meet the above conditions according to the type and conditions of the training occupation proposed by the Japanese receiving organization, and then the Japanese side determines the qualified candidates from among the candidates.

    9.Have a healthy body that can withstand training! No dental required**.

If according to the official explanation, this training visa is a good visa, maybe Japan does not issue this training visa to obtain cheap labor, but simply wants to make some contributions to foreign friends. However, this visa has provided a new way for some intermediaries and organizations to make money - they have directly turned the training visa into a way to work in Japan.

    2. The specific method is: find a company (usually a factory) for the customer who wants to apply for a study visa, and falsely claim to send employees to Japan to learn advanced technology in the name of this company, and send the customer to Japan to work. And in the process, the intermediary can get two considerable incomes:

    High intermediary fees (15,000+) for clients to apply for study visas; The commission given by the Japanese company.

    3. It is worth noting that, in addition to intermediaries, some technical secondary schools or vocational schools are also doing such projects: they require students to go to Japan for internship in the third year of secondary school, and in fact, after students arrive there, they basically become cheap labor, and schools can get a generous commission paid by Japanese companies for manual inspection and introduction.
